Vitec Software Group AB: Bulletin from Vitec Software Group AB's Annual General Meeting, April 23 2018

Report this content

Approval of income statement and balance sheet

The Annual General Meeting (AGM) approved the income statement and balance sheet for the Parent Company and the consolidated income statement and consolidated balance sheet for 2017.

Dividend
The proposed dividend of SEK 1.10 per share was approved by the AGM. The record date for the dividend is Wednesday, April 25 2018. Payment from Euroclear Sweden AB is expected Monday, April 30, 2018.

Discharge
Board members and the President were discharged from liability for the financial year 2017.

Board of Directors
In accordance with the proposal of the Nomination Committee, Crister Stjernfelt was re-elected Chairman of the Board of Directors. Anna Valtonen, Birgitta Johansson-Hedberg, Jan Friedman and Kaj Sandart were re-elected to the Board.

Directors' fees
The Meeting decided, in accordance with the Nomination Committee's proposal for an annual fee to the Chairman of SEK 270,000 and the other board members of the Board of SEK 135,000 each.

Auditor
The AGM re-elected PricewaterhouseCoopers AB, with Niklas Renström as responsible auditor, for the period up until the end of the AGM 2019.

Guidelines for remuneration to senior executives
In accordance with the Board's proposal the AGM approved the guidelines for remuneration to senior executives. Senior executives refer to the CEO and other members of management.

About Vitec
Vitec is market leader for Vertical Market Software in the Nordic region. We develop and deliver standard niche software. Vitec grows through acquisitions of well-managed and well-established software companies. The Group's overall processes together with the employees' in-depth knowledge of the customer's local market enables continuous improvement and innovation. Our 600 employees are based in Denmark, Finland, Norway and Sweden. Vitec is listed on Nasdaq Stockholm and had net sales of SEK 855 million in 2017. Find more at www.vitecsoftware.com.
